Ivanovic, the tournament's top seed, got off to a quick start against Zvonareva, taking just some 10 minutes to win the first four games against her Russian opponent.
"She beat me a few times quite easy, so I knew I had to be active and sharp from the first moment on to put pressure on her," said Ivanovic, who had split four previous matches against Zvonareva.
Ivanovic, who lost to Maria Sharapova in the Australian Open final, was to face Jankovic in one semi-final yesterday, with the other pitting Russians Sharapova and Svetlana Kuznetsova.
The women's and men's finals are tomorrow.
